This Rapper Sang Dhurandhar's FA9LA
In the film Dhurandhar, actor Akshaye Khanna plays the villain Rahman Dacoit. The song FA9LA was used for his role in the movie, and it was created by Flipperachi and his team. It's a Bahraini song, and the rapper is Flipperachi. His real name is Hussam Assim, and he is quite famous in the United Arab Emirates for his rap style and songs.
Flipperachi developed an interest in music at a young age, and today he is recognized internationally for his singing talent. Flipperachi's FA9LA song, featured in Dhurandhar, was originally released in 2024, and now it has been re-released and filmed on Akshaye Khanna in Ranveer Singh's movie.
The song has received more than 7 million views on YouTube. However, after being featured in Dhurandhar, its viewership is rapidly increasing, and the song is currently trending at number one across India. Numerous users are creating reels on Instagram using this song.

Akshaye Khanna Choreographed the Dance Steps for the Song
Dhurandhar actor Danish recently revealed this in a latest interview with Filmygyan. There was no dance choreographer for the song FA9LA from the film Dhurandhar; instead, Akshaye Khanna himself started dancing to it in his own style, which the film's director loved.
